Is Your Teen Making the Most of Their Tuition Sessions?

One-on-one and small group tuition provide a valuable opportunity for your teen to receive personalised learning outside the busy classroom environment. It’s important to make the most of this personalised setting. Rather than relying on the tutor for assistance on completing homework and other assignments, encourage your teen to use these sessions to get focused support on areas where they need extra support. Tackling their homework and assignments beforehand can help them identify the specific questions or problems they are struggling with so they can bring them up during the sessions.

 
Here are four strategies your teen can employ to make the most of their tuition sessions:
 

1. Preparation is Key

Encourage your teen to review their homework, assignments, or class notes before the tuition session. This will help them pinpoint areas where they need additional support.

2. Set Clear Goals

Help your teen set specific goals for each session. Whether it’s understanding a particular concept, improving on a skill, or preparing for an upcoming exam, having a clear objective will keep the session focused.

3. Communicate with the Tutor

Encourage your teen to communicate openly with their tutor about their learning goals and the areas they’re struggling with. This will help the tutor tailor the session to meet your teen’s specific needs.

4. Practice, Practice, Practice

After the session, encourage your teen to practice what they’ve learned. This could be through additional exercises, quizzes, or even teaching the concept to someone else.

 

By taking a proactive and targeted approach to their tuition sessions, your teen can maximise their learning potential and make the most of this valuable resource. Becoming an active participant in their education will have them well on their way to academic success!
